From 579f4c1390f1362a48d5a3a77bd7d17f02cf5216 Mon Sep 17 00:00:00 2001 From: zzp <34701892@qq.com> Date: Fri, 12 Sep 2025 16:57:40 +0800 Subject: [PATCH] =?UTF-8?q?style:=20=E7=BB=9F=E4=B8=80=E4=BD=BF=E7=94=A8?= =?UTF-8?q?=20#3C74F1=20=E4=BD=9C=E4=B8=BA=E4=B8=BB=E8=89=B2=E8=B0=83?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it - 将实时信息页面的激活状态边框和背景色改为 #3C74F1 - 更新折线图组件的颜色配置,使用 #3C74F1 替代原有颜色 - 添加备用颜色列表并注释掉未使用的颜色函数 --- src/components/charts/LineHol.vue | 8 ++++++-- src/components/charts/LineHolYellow.vue | 4 ++++ src/pages/realtimeInfo/index.vue | 4 ++-- 3 files changed, 12 insertions(+), 4 deletions(-) diff --git a/src/components/charts/LineHol.vue b/src/components/charts/LineHol.vue index cbd3d74..17d075d 100644 --- a/src/components/charts/LineHol.vue +++ b/src/components/charts/LineHol.vue @@ -31,7 +31,7 @@ watch( } } ); - +const colorList = ["#F05040", "#696BBE", "#93CFED", "#FE9F19", "#3C74F1", "#F05040", "#696BBE", "#93CFED", "#FE9F19", "#3C74F1"]; // 初始化图表 const initChart = () => { myChart = echarts.init(chartDom.value); @@ -127,9 +127,13 @@ const initChart = () => { show: true, }, itemStyle: { - color: "#52A8FF", + color: "#3C74F1", normal: { borderRadius: [0, 4, 4, 0], + color: "#3C74F1", + // color: function (params) { + // return colorList[params.dataIndex]; + // }, }, }, data: Object.keys(builderJson.charts).map(function (key) { diff --git a/src/components/charts/LineHolYellow.vue b/src/components/charts/LineHolYellow.vue index 4bd5b9b..d9177fc 100644 --- a/src/components/charts/LineHolYellow.vue +++ b/src/components/charts/LineHolYellow.vue @@ -95,6 +95,10 @@ const initChart = () => { color: "#FFCE34", normal: { borderRadius: [0, 4, 4, 0], + color: "#3C74F1", + // color: function (params) { + // return colorList[params.dataIndex]; + // }, }, }, encode: { diff --git a/src/pages/realtimeInfo/index.vue b/src/pages/realtimeInfo/index.vue index 2e6924f..1b5fddf 100644 --- a/src/pages/realtimeInfo/index.vue +++ b/src/pages/realtimeInfo/index.vue @@ -496,8 +496,8 @@ onMounted(async () => { } .active { - border: 1px solid #007bff; - background-color: #007bff; + border: 1px solid #3c74f1; + background-color: #3c74f1; color: #fff; } }